The childrens books of enid blyton were illustrated by a large number of artists, ranging from figures known for other work to humbler commercial artists, who in some cases were anonymous. After beeks death in 1953 the original style was maintained by illustrators robert tyndall, peter wienk, mary brooks and robert lee. Since the blyton texts mainly used very simple language, the work of the illustrators was an important part of the appeal of many of the works.
